Mary Ellen Tooman, aged 58, passed away at home peacefully on March 13, 2025, leaving behind a legacy of love and compassion.She had A terminal illness.Born on October 25, 1966, in Bountiful, Utah, Mary was the beloved daughter of Clyde Clayton Tooman and Rita Rose Ferrenberg. Educated at the Arizona College of Nursing in Tempe, Mary graduated and began her journey as a caring and dedicated nurse.Throughout her career, Mary had the privilege of working at several reputable institutions. Her skills as a Triage Nurse were put to use at the Arizona State Hospital. She later joined Twin Peaks Hospital as a Registered Nurse, where her warmth and professionalism shone through. Finally, Mary lent her compassionate care to patients at Grifols Bio Mat. Her loving care for her patient,s will not be forgotten.Mary's dedication to her profession was only surpassed by her love for animals. She had a special fondness for dogs, with her favorites being Tank, a Bulldog, Kona, a mix of Pitbull and Labrador, and Hazel, her loyal hound dog. However, it was her passion for horses that truly captured her heart. Sir Dominic and her stunning brown and white paint quarter horse brought her immeasurable joy. From a young age, Mary formed a bond with animals, even sleeping in the barn with her lamb named Buttons. She gave her treats such as licorice and Oreos. Mary's kind and gentle nature touched the lives of both humans and animals alike.As a devoted believer, Mary was A member of Olafs Catholic Church, attending elementary school at Saint Olafs and high school at Judge Memorial.. She found solace and strength in her faith, which guided her throughout her life.Her mother Rita Rose Tooman,father Clyde Clayton Tooman(ret Navy) and brother Timmothy Gerrad Tooman Awaither her in heaven.Mary is survived by her cherished daughter, Bayliegh Hatch,grand daughter and grandson,brothers, John Tooman, Paul Tooman and Roger Tooman, along with sisters Carol Tooman and Sue Tooman, mourn her loss but find comfort in the memories shared together.Patrick Carroll will forever hold Mary's spirit in his heart as her loving partner.In lieu of flowers, the family kindly requests donations to be made to the charitable organization that meant so much to Mary, non-profit animal shelters. Your support will ensure that Mary's dedication to the welfare of animals continues to make a difference.Mary Ellen Tooman will forever be remembered for her unwavering commitment to caring for others, her boundless love for animals, and her kind and giving spirit. May she rest in eternal peace, leaving behind a legacy that will continue to inspire and uplift us all.Rest In Peace.We Love You Mary
